I've been used to my Ety HF2s for years, but now am looking for one or two sets of IEMs.  Looking for HiFi or neutral signature.   Hoping for more bass than Etys, but not overpowering.  So, I don't mind the highs rolling off so long as the bass doesnt get in the way (which it does in Shure SE215s, to my ear).
 
-One for everyday use, under $200, for subway, phone calls, sleeping, street walking, etc.  Really want decent isolation.  Maybe not as good as the Etys, but close.    
-One for sleeping, home use, and trips, with awesome sound and isolation.  $600 is max here.
 
Would love to swap replacement cables so I could use with phone for phone calls.
 
What do I listen to?  A lot of post-rock (Explosions In the Sky), classic rock, indie/alt-rock, some classical, some jazz. Once in a while hip-hop.  
 
I tend to have slightly smaller ear canals (I find the JVD HXFD80s super uncomfortable, but the Shure's pretty comfortable, save for the memory wire).
